Creating Wild Lettuce Extract: A Natural Solution for Pain and Sleep

Placement in Glass Jar:
  • Deposit the chopped or crushed leaves in a glass jar, filling it to the halfway mark, and avoiding overpacking.
Alcohol Addition:
  • Introduce the high-proof alcohol to the jar, ensuring the leaves are submerged completely. The alcohol level should surpass the plant matter.
Jar Sealing:
  • Tightly secure the jar with its lid.
Storage and Shaking:
  • Store the jar in a dark, cool space for a minimum of two to four weeks, shaking it mildly every few days.
Straining:
  • Post the steeping duration, strain the concoction using a refined strainer or cheesecloth into another sanitized container, extracting the maximum liquid possible.
Preservation in Bottles:
  • Pour the strained fluid (now your wild lettuce extract) into dark glass bottles for safeguarding. The dark bottles assist in shielding the extract from light, preventing degradation. Clearly label the bottles with the date and the contents.
Determining Dosage:
  • Commence with a minimal dosage, like a few drops, and progressively augment it as necessary. Dosage is individual-specific, necessitating caution and observation of its bodily impacts.

Important Note:

Although wild lettuce is acclaimed for its potential sedative and analgesic attributes, its usage necessitates caution and ideally, supervision from a healthcare professional, particularly for those pregnant, nursing, or on medications. Interactions with particular medications and diverse side effects are possible. Prioritize consultation with healthcare professionals before employing herbal remedies for explicit health issues.
